A tool designed to determine the appropriate amount of sulfadimethoxine, a common antibiotic marketed under the brand name Albon, for canine patients facilitates accurate administration. This typically involves inputting the dog’s weight and the concentration of the Albon suspension to calculate the precise dose. For example, a specific dosage might be determined based on milligrams of Albon per kilogram of the dog’s body weight.

Accurate dosing of sulfadimethoxine is critical for effective treatment of bacterial infections in dogs while minimizing the risk of potential side effects. Underdosing can lead to treatment failure and antimicrobial resistance, while overdosing may result in adverse reactions. 1. Weight-Based Dosage

Weight-based dosage is paramount for determining the correct Albon quantity for canines. This approach ensures therapeutic efficacy while minimizing adverse effects. A precise dosage, tailored to the individual animal’s weight, maximizes the drug’s effectiveness against bacterial infections.

  • Dosage Calculation

    Calculating the correct dosage involves using the dog’s weight in kilograms and the Albon concentration (mg/ml). A typical formula might involve multiplying the dog’s weight by a prescribed dosage in mg/kg, then dividing by the Albon concentration. For instance, a 10kg dog requiring 50mg/kg of Albon from a 250mg/ml suspension would need 2ml of Albon. Calculators streamline this process, reducing potential errors.

  • Impact of Weight Variations

    Weight differences significantly influence the prescribed Albon volume. A smaller dog naturally requires a smaller dose compared to a larger dog, even if both suffer from the same infection. For example, a 5kg dog might receive half the Albon volume of a 10kg dog, assuming all other factors remain constant. Disregarding weight variations can lead to ineffective treatment or toxicity.

  • Concentration Considerations

    Albon is available in different concentrations. Therefore, the same weight-based dosage might translate to different administered volumes depending on the concentration. A higher concentration requires a smaller volume to deliver the same amount of active ingredient. Using the wrong concentration in calculations can lead to significant dosage errors. Therefore, the calculator must account for this variability.

2. Concentration Variations

Sulfadimethoxine, commonly known as Albon, is available in various concentrations, typically expressed as milligrams per milliliter (mg/ml). This variation necessitates careful consideration when calculating dosages. An effective dosage calculator must accommodate these concentration differences to ensure accurate administration. Failing to account for concentration variations can lead to significant dosing errors, potentially resulting in treatment failure or toxicity. For instance, using a calculation intended for a 500 mg/ml suspension with a 250 mg/ml product would result in administering double the intended dose.

The relationship between concentration and dosage is inversely proportional. A higher concentration requires a smaller volume to deliver the same amount of active ingredient. A dosage calculator addresses this by incorporating the specific concentration into its formula. This allows users to input the concentration of the available Albon suspension, ensuring the calculated dose corresponds to the correct volume. For example, if a dog requires 250 mg of sulfadimethoxine and the available suspension is 250 mg/ml, the calculated dose would be 1 ml. However, if the concentration is 500 mg/ml, the calculated dose would be 0.5 ml.

3. Veterinary Consultation Crucial

While online tools offer convenient dosage estimations, relying solely on an Albon dosage calculator for dogs presents potential risks. Veterinary consultation remains crucial for several reasons. Firstly, calculators cannot diagnose the underlying condition. They determine the appropriate dosage for a given weight and concentration but cannot discern whether Albon is the appropriate treatment. A dog exhibiting similar symptoms might require a different antibiotic, or Albon might be contraindicated due to pre-existing health conditions or drug interactions. For example, a dog with kidney disease may require a reduced dosage or a different antibiotic altogether. Relying solely on a calculator overlooks crucial diagnostic considerations.

Secondly, calculators cannot account for individual patient variability. While weight serves as a primary factor in dosage calculations, other factors such as age, breed, and overall health can influence drug metabolism and efficacy. A senior dog or a dog with compromised liver function might process Albon differently than a healthy adult dog, necessitating dosage adjustments. A veterinarian can assess these individual factors and tailor the dosage accordingly. Overlooking such nuances can lead to suboptimal treatment outcomes or increased risk of adverse effects.

Finally, calculators cannot monitor treatment response or manage potential complications. A veterinarian assesses the dog’s progress throughout the treatment period, adjusting the dosage or changing the medication if necessary. They also monitor for potential side effects and provide appropriate interventions. For instance, if a dog develops gastrointestinal upset while on Albon, a veterinarian might recommend supportive care or consider an alternative antibiotic. Essential Tips for Utilizing Sulfadimethoxine Dosage Calculators

Accurate dosage calculation is paramount for effective treatment and minimizing potential risks associated with sulfadimethoxine administration in canines. These tips provide practical guidance for utilizing online calculators responsibly and emphasize the importance of veterinary oversight.

Tip 1: Verify the Calculator’s Reliability: Ensure the chosen online calculator originates from a reputable source, such as a veterinary professional organization or a well-established veterinary pharmaceutical website. Reputable sources ensure the accuracy and validity of the calculations.

Tip 2: Double-Check Inputs: Errors in entering the dog’s weight or the medication’s concentration can lead to significant dosage inaccuracies. Meticulous verification of these inputs is crucial before relying on the calculated result.

Tip 3: Understand Units of Measurement: Ensure consistency in units of measurement. Most calculators require weight in kilograms and concentration in mg/ml. Converting units correctly avoids calculation errors. For example, convert pounds to kilograms before entering the weight.

Tip 4: Consider Individual Patient Factors: While calculators provide a general guideline, individual factors such as age, underlying health conditions, and concurrent medications can influence the optimal dosage. Veterinary consultation is essential to address these individual needs.

Tip 5: Monitor for Adverse Reactions: Even with accurate dosage calculations, adverse reactions can occur. Observe the dog closely for any unusual signs, such as vomiting, diarrhea, or lethargy, and contact a veterinarian immediately if any concerns arise.

Tip 6: Do Not Self-Adjust Dosage: If the dog’s condition does not improve or worsens, resist the urge to adjust the dosage independently. Consult a veterinarian for reassessment and potential dosage adjustments or alternative treatments.
